                     RESOLUTIONS SUBMITTED EN BLOC

  Mr. CARDIN. Mr. President, I ask unanimous consent that the Senate 
proceed to the immediate consideration of the following resolutions en 
bloc: Calendar No. 375, S. Res. 341; Calendar No. 376, S. Res. 390; 
Calendar No. 377, S. Res. 499; Calendar No. 379, S. Res. 538; Calendar 
No. 380, S. Res. 615; and Calendar No. 381, S. Res. 632.
  There being no objection, the Senate proceeded to consider the 
resolutions en bloc, which had been reported from the Committee on 
Foreign Relations.
  Mr. CARDIN. I know of no further debate on the resolutions en bloc.
  The PRESIDING OFFICER. If there is no further debate, the question is 
on the adoption of the resolutions en bloc.
  The resolutions were agreed to.
  Mr. CARDIN. I ask unanimous consent that the preambles be agreed to 
and that the motions to reconsider be considered made and laid upon the 
table with no intervening action or debate, all en bloc.
  The PRESIDING OFFICER. Without objection, it is so ordered.
  The preambles were agreed to.
